The club has announced the passing of Ilona, the wife of St. Louis City player Eduard Lowen. Her death was confirmed through a statement expressing grief and offering support to Eduard and their loved ones.
Ilona was diagnosed with brain cancer in 2024 after experiencing severe headaches. Despite multiple surgeries, doctors informed the couple that the cancer had progressed to an incurable Stage 4, a condition that followed an earlier diagnosis of a benign brain tumor.
Eduard Lowen has been absent from matches this season, focusing on his wife's care. He previously stated his commitment to being present for her during unexpected health challenges, acknowledging his responsibilities as a husband.
Lowen, a native of Germany, joined St. Louis City in 2022. He has recorded 17 goals and nine assists in 71 regular-season MLS matches.
